正文 首页欧宝竞技球场

adc三种编程方式,如何使用ADC

ming

在HAL库中,支持三种编程模式:轮询模式、中断模式、DMA模式(如果外设支持)。其分别对应如下三种类型的函数(以ADC为例): HAL_StatusTypeDefHAL_ADC_Start(ADC_HandleTypeDef* hadc); H41. 滚珠丝杠螺母副可以分为外循环插管式式和内循环反相器式两种。42. AD574A是12位逐次逼近式的ADC芯片。43. 直流伺服电动机调节特性与横轴的交点为电动机的始动电压。44

TOP2:编程要点1-独立模式-单通道-中断读取①、初始化ADC用到的GPIO; ②、设置ADC的工作参数并初始化;③、配置ADC时钟;④、设置ADC转换通道顺序及采样时间;ADC使用步骤第一步:清零ADC控制和状态寄存器:ADCSRAADCSRA0x00;第二步:设置ADC多工选择寄存器:ADMUXADMUX0b01000000;第三步:设置ADC控制和状态寄存器:ADCSRAAD

可编程的(转换频率的)预分频:fMASTER可以被分频2到18 可以选择ADC专用外部中断(ADC_ETR)或者定时器触发信号(TRGO)来作为外部触发信号模拟放大(对于具有VREF引脚的型号) 转换结束时可产生中断灵以下分别讲述三种不同方式(单通道、多通道、基于DMA的多通道采集)的ADC应用实例:/*单通道的ADC采集*/ void Adc_Config(void) { /*定义两个初始化要用的结构体,下面给每个结构体成

∪0∪ ADC的一般过程采样/ 量化/ 编码采样采样和保持电路所构成。量化编码也就是adc 的位数常见的ADC的方法并行ADC(闪速,flash型) 如上图,8个电压等级的,3位ADC 这也就说明了,8相比较于独立模式多通道电压采集实验,其实双重ADC同步模式实验就是多了另一个ADC同步而已,只是有些地方在配置和编程时需要注意而已,而且本文用的是单通道ADC。双重ADC相对于独立模

这里的ADC转换也来使用DMA---这个也是STM32的ADC转换最常见的方式。第一步是了解STM32的ADC对应的GPIO口如下图不用记住,可以查询,我是将它剪下来粘贴到书本记录一下STM32的ADC编程方法!前面已经学习了DMA,知道如何使用DMA去减小CPU的负担,这里的ADC转换也来使用DMA---这个也是STM32的ADC转换最常见的方式。--第一

版权免责声明 1、本文标题:《adc三种编程方式,如何使用ADC》
2、本文来源于,版权归原作者所有,转载请注明出处!
3、本网站所有内容仅代表作者本人的观点,与本网站立场无关,作者文责自负。
4、本网站内容来自互联网,对于不当转载或引用而引起的民事纷争、行政处理或其他损失,本网不承担责任。
5、如果有侵权内容、不妥之处,请第一时间联系我们删除。嘀嘀嘀 QQ:XXXXXBB